What Key Features Define the Best Gaming Platform Desk?

The best gaming platform desks are defined by several key features that enhance both functionality and comfort for gamers.

  • Ergonomic Design: An ergonomic design promotes good posture and reduces the risk of strain during long gaming sessions. Features like adjustable height and a curved shape can accommodate different body types and preferences, ensuring that gamers can sit comfortably for hours.
  • Sturdy Construction: A well-built desk provides stability and durability, essential for supporting gaming equipment like multiple monitors, gaming consoles, and accessories. Materials such as high-quality wood, metal, or reinforced composites ensure that the desk can withstand the weight and motion associated with intense gaming.
  • Ample Surface Area: A generous surface area allows gamers to spread out their equipment, including monitors, keyboards, mice, and speakers, without feeling cramped. This feature is essential for multitasking and enjoying an immersive gaming experience with everything within easy reach.
  • Cable Management: Integrated cable management solutions help keep cords organized and out of sight, reducing clutter and providing a clean aesthetic. This not only enhances the overall appearance of the gaming setup but also prevents tangles and damage to cables over time.
  • Adjustable Features: Many of the best gaming desks come with adjustable features such as height, angle, and even built-in cooling fans. These adjustments allow for a personalized gaming experience that can adapt to different gaming styles or preferences, enhancing comfort and performance.
  • Storage Options: Built-in storage solutions, such as shelves, drawers, or compartments, help keep gaming accessories organized and easily accessible. This feature is particularly beneficial for gamers who have a large collection of gear or prefer a tidy workspace.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: The design and color of a gaming desk can significantly impact the overall look of a gaming setup. Many desks come in various styles and finishes, allowing gamers to choose one that complements their gaming environment and personal taste.

What Are the Advantages of Using an Adjustable Gaming Platform Desk?

The advantages of using an adjustable gaming platform desk include flexibility, ergonomic benefits, and enhanced organization.

  • Flexibility: An adjustable gaming platform desk allows users to easily switch between sitting and standing positions, catering to personal preference and different gaming styles. This adaptability can enhance comfort during long gaming sessions and accommodate various user heights.
  • Ergonomic Benefits: By enabling a user to adjust the desk height, these platforms promote better posture and reduce the risk of strain or injury. Proper ergonomic alignment can lead to improved focus and performance while gaming, as players can maintain a comfortable setup.
  • Enhanced Organization: Many adjustable gaming desks come with built-in features such as cable management systems, monitor stands, and storage options. This helps keep the gaming area tidy, ensuring that gamers have quick access to their gear while minimizing distractions.
  • Increased Space Efficiency: Adjustable desks can often be configured to fit various room sizes and layouts, making them ideal for small spaces. Their versatility allows gamers to optimize their environments for both gaming and other activities, such as studying or working.
  • Improved Workflow: For gamers who also stream or create content, adjustable desks can provide a seamless transition between different tasks. The ability to modify the desk height can facilitate better video framing, camera angles, and overall workspace efficiency.

What Budget Considerations Should You Keep in Mind for a Gaming Desk?

When choosing the best gaming platform desk, several budget considerations are essential to ensure you get the most value for your investment.

  • Material Quality: The materials used in the desk’s construction significantly affect its durability and longevity. Desks made from high-quality wood or metal are typically more expensive but offer better support and resistance to wear and tear compared to cheaper particle board options.
  • Size and Space: Consider the desk size in relation to your gaming setup and available space. Larger desks can cost more, but they provide ample room for multiple monitors, gaming peripherals, and personal items, enhancing your overall gaming experience.
  • Ergonomics: An ergonomic design is critical for comfort during long gaming sessions. While ergonomic desks may be pricier, investing in one can prevent strain and injury, ultimately saving you money on potential health-related expenses.
  • Features and Accessories: Look for desks that come with built-in features such as cable management systems, adjustable height settings, or integrated lighting. These added functionalities can increase the desk’s price but can significantly enhance your gaming setup and organization.
  • Brand Reputation: Established brands often charge a premium for their products due to their reputation for quality and customer service. Investing in a reputable brand can provide peace of mind and better warranty options, which may save you costs in the long run.
  • Shipping and Assembly Costs: When budgeting, don’t forget to factor in shipping fees and any assembly costs if you’re purchasing a desk that requires setup. Some retailers offer free delivery, while others may charge significant fees, impacting your overall budget.
